Output 7366f84f7fdbc386e1a829e6b91eec11cd135e8fe9bebd21e671e724ca6e61fd:1

value
988337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f7c06fde78c119969b7f7f46c2572f7439b7ea OP_EQUAL
address
3Mep2TEiZ1SeffBWzvn82Mnb2PPZc8N6dA
transaction
7366f84f7fdbc386e1a829e6b91eec11cd135e8fe9bebd21e671e724ca6e61fd
spent
true